
The club is delighted to announce the arrival of centre-half Josh Allen from Richmond Town as Jason Newall's first signing as Manager.
Josh, 29, teams up again with his former boss after playing a pivotal role in the Richmond side following his move from local side Bedale AFC midway through the 2022/23 season. He went on to make 48 appearances, scoring once, during his time at Richmond.
Josh is a local lad and currently resides in Northallerton and had the following to say upon making the step up to Northern League football and joining the club:
"I can't wait to make the step up to the Northern League and test myself at this level. I know what Jason expects from his players and I'm really looking forward to a successful season with my local club.
I'm a hard-working, no-nonsense defender who is very adaptable and equally at home in a back four or in the middle of a three. I'm keen to keep improving and establish myself at this level."
Manager, Jason Newall on his first signing:
"Josh was the foundation of my Richmond side, he'll give attackers a tough challenge.
"He's an exceptional one-on-one defender who is hard to beat. Josh improved massively at Richmond after his step up from Bedale and this is the next level in his football development.
"He also fits into my model of finding the best local players to play for Northallerton."
